Displayport IP Market Platform Offers Comprehensive Solutions for Every Resolution and Interface
The Displayport IP Market platform landscape is diverse and technologically sophisticated, offering a range of IP cores, verification solutions, and design tools tailored to different resolution requirements, interface types, and DisplayPort versions. The platforms within this market vary significantly in terms of bandwidth capabilities, power consumption, and feature support, providing semiconductor companies with considerable flexibility in choosing solutions that align with their specific display interface requirements, target applications, and design constraints. DisplayPort 2.1 currently holds the largest version segment, thanks to its superior bandwidth capabilities that enable enhanced visual fidelity and support for next-generation displays and gaming setups. DisplayPort 1.4a is the fastest-growing version segment, gaining traction due to its compatibility with existing infrastructure and its ability to support high dynamic range content, appealing to a wide range of consumers from gaming enthusiasts to content creators.
The platform capabilities of modern DisplayPort IP solutions extend beyond basic video transmission. Contemporary IP cores incorporate advanced features such as support for multiple resolutions up to 8K and beyond, high dynamic range for enhanced color and contrast, variable refresh rates for smoother gaming experiences, and advanced error correction for reliable transmission over longer distances. The integration of DisplayPort with USB-C and Thunderbolt interfaces is enabling unified connectivity solutions that support power delivery, data transfer, and video transmission through a single cable, simplifying device design and user experience. The development of specialized IP for different end device types, including graphics cards, motherboards, monitors, projectors, and TVs, is enabling semiconductor companies to choose solutions that address their specific application requirements. The emergence of IP with low power consumption and small footprint is enabling integration into portable and battery-powered devices.
The resolution landscape shows 4K currently holding the largest market share due to its prevalence in high-end displays and gaming applications, with its superior image quality catering to high-end consumer electronics, gaming, and professional displays. 2K resolution is the fastest-growing segment, appealing to gamers and professionals seeking enhanced visual clarity without the premium costs associated with 4K, serving as an optimal midpoint for users who demand enhanced clarity yet are conscious of budget constraints. Full HD remains significant, yet it is being progressively overshadowed by the growing demand for higher resolutions. The interface type landscape shows eDP (Embedded DisplayPort) currently holding the largest market share due to its extensive implementation in laptops and tablets, offering high bandwidth and power efficiency for mobile devices. USB-C is gaining traction because of its versatility and compatibility with multiple devices, while wDP (Wireless DisplayPort) is the fastest-growing segment, propelled by the rising adoption of wireless technology offering enhanced convenience and flexibility for users.
The platform landscape also varies significantly by end device type and region. Monitors currently hold the largest end device segment, driven by increasing demand for high-resolution displays in gaming, professional, and consumer applications. Graphics Cards are the fastest-growing segment, known for their ability to provide high-quality graphics rendering and support for advanced gaming technologies. North America currently holds the largest regional market share, driven by rapid technological advancements and increasing demand for high-resolution displays. Asia-Pacific is the fastest-growing region, fueled by increasing consumer electronics demand, particularly in countries like China and Japan. The future of DisplayPort IP platforms lies in continued advancement of bandwidth capabilities, enhanced support for emerging display technologies, and the development of comprehensive solutions that can address the evolving needs of semiconductor companies across different resolutions, interface types, and applications.
